Description of key information

The ready biodegradability of the test item was determined with non-adapted activated sludge in the Manometric Respirometry Test for a period of 28 days according to OECD guideline 301 F .The test item concentration selected as appropriate was 30 mg/L, corresponding to a ThOD of 51 mg O2/L per test vessel.
The mean oxygen depletion in the inoculum control was 9.9 mg O2/L on day 28. The pass level > 60 % was reached by the functional control within 2 days. The biodegradation reached a maximum of 100 % degradation on day 27. In the toxicity control containing both test and reference item 64 % degradation occurred within 14 days with a maximum of 68% after 28 days. The test item does not inhibit the bacteria in the sewage sludge.
Both test item replicates reached the 10 % level (beginning of biodegradation) within 1 day. The 60 % pass level was not reached within 28 days by the test item replicates. After 28 days the mean biodegradation was 40 %.
 
The validity criteria of the guideline are fulfilled.

Additional information

Both test item replicates reached the 10 % level (beginning of biodegradation) within 1 day. The 60 % pass level was not reached within 28 days by the test item replicates. After 28 days the mean biodegradation was 40 %. The test item is classified as not readily biodegradable within 28 days.
